Transaction dd6880226d1702abdaaa10f894a2851c0bcb59ef2b60cf7684f48b13978aebdd
1 Input
1 Output
-
dd6880226d1702abdaaa10f894a2851c0bcb59ef2b60cf7684f48b13978aebdd:0
- value
- 2094394
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f47817bd98da5ef26626388dfec097f8609f6e1
- address
- bc1q8arcz77e3kj77fnzvwydlmqf07rqnahprmd0wc